Essay questions
These essay questions are meant to be used as a starting point for your essay or research paper.
- How does Spinoza define God in his book 'Ethics'?
- Discuss Spinoza's view on the nature of human emotions and desires as presented in 'Ethics'.
- Explain the concept of 'conatus' in Spinoza's 'Ethics' and its significance in his ethical framework.
- What is Spinoza's understanding of freedom and determinism, and how does it relate to his ethical theory?
- Discuss the role of reason and intuition in Spinoza's ethical philosophy, as outlined in 'Ethics'.
- How does Spinoza's concept of 'substance' contribute to his overall ethical theory in 'Ethics'?
- Explore Spinoza's perspective on the mind-body relationship and its implications for ethical understanding, as discussed in 'Ethics'.
